Code P0152 2011 Nissan Pathfinder Description

The diagnostic trouble code P0152 in a 2011 Nissan Pathfinder indicates an issue with the Air Fuel Ratio (A/F) sensor circuit on Bank 2 Sensor 1. This sensor is responsible for measuring the oxygen content in the exhaust gases and providing feedback to the engine control module (ECM) to adjust the air-fuel mixture for optimal combustion. When the ECM detects a high voltage signal from the A/F sensor, it triggers the P0152 code.

Common Causes of P0152 2011 Nissan Pathfinder

  1. Faulty A/F sensor
  2. Wiring issues (shorts, opens, or corrosion)
  3. ECM malfunction
  4. Exhaust leaks near the sensor
  5. Engine coolant leaks contaminating the sensor

Symptoms of P0152 2011 Nissan Pathfinder

  1. Decreased fuel economy
  2. Rough idling or stalling
  3. Poor acceleration
  4. Engine misfires
  5. Increased emissions

How to Fix P0152 2011 Nissan Pathfinder

  1. Begin by conducting a visual inspection of the A/F sensor and its wiring harness to check for any visible damage or corrosion.
  2. Use a multimeter to test the sensor's voltage output and resistance to determine if it is functioning within specifications.
  3. If the sensor is faulty, replace it with a new OEM or high-quality aftermarket sensor.
  4. Check and repair any damaged wiring or connectors in the sensor circuit.
  5. Clear the diagnostic trouble codes from the ECM using a scan tool and perform a test drive to verify that the issue has been resolved.

Cost to Fix P0152 2011 Nissan Pathfinder

The cost of repairing a P0152 code in a 2011 Nissan Pathfinder can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the cost of parts and labor in your area. Generally, the cost of a new A/F sensor can range from $100 to $300, while the labor cost for diagnosis and replacement can be between $100 and $200. Therefore, the total repair cost could be anywhere from $200 to $500. It is advisable to consult with a trusted mechanic or auto repair shop for a more accurate estimate based on your vehicle's specific needs. Labor rates at auto repair shops typically range from $80 to $150 per hour, but can vary based on location and other factors.

Tech Notes for P0152 2011 Nissan Pathfinder

Replacing the Air fuel ratio (A/F) sensor 1 bank 2 usually takes care of the problem.

When is the Code Detected?

The Air Fuel Ratio (A/F) signal computed by Engine Control Module (ECM) from the A/F sensor 1 signal is constantly approx. 5V.
